Transaction 6f8b340661d996915fd91ab14a8fb240894c4850efc0b485d0b3f2fc2f3b1881
1 Input
1 Output
-
6f8b340661d996915fd91ab14a8fb240894c4850efc0b485d0b3f2fc2f3b1881:0
- value
- 13015997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4174355d5856d2820e92e30e4e97ede2aec6546c OP_EQUAL
- address
- 37f74KPFmsGPAMoEzMDBDkdNN6gU4hJ3UB